PRE-GAME BREAKDOWN
Due to the schedule the Army Men did not play on Alexander Gomelsky Universal Sports Hall floor for two months, since December 8.
No changes expected on the Red-Blues roster. Injured Will Clyburn, Andrey Lopatin, Nikola Milutinov and Toko Shengelia remain out.
WORD TO THE COACH
Dimitris Itoudis, CSKA head coach:
We have three VTB League games in a row in front of us, and we start from Kalev. They have a new team, that had some players injured but practically all of them are coming back so we expect them to be in full strength. They play aggressive basketball with their point guards creating. We definitely have different level of loading, but now our only thought is to win the game.

SHORT DOSSIER
Kalev/Kramo Tallinn, Estonia
Founded: 1998
Colors: blue, white
Homecourt: Saku Suurhalland Kalevi Spordihall (6,000)
President: Tomas Linamae
Head coach: Roberts Stelmahers
Website: www.bckalev.ee
Trophy case: 11-time Estonian champion (2005, 06, 09, 11-14, 16-19), 6-time Estonian Cup winner (2005-08, 16, 17)
